Tracheoesophageal Fistula: 
Congenital birth defect 
DX: based on signs/symptoms and confirmed by x-ray Polyhydramnios earliest sign before birth 
3 “C”s – coughing, choking, cyanosis after birth (vomit and choke on first feeding) Drooling and abdominal distention 
NPO for surgery 
TX: Immediate surgery for survival, suctioning to keep airway clear, Elevate HOB, Monitor for signs of respiratory distress

Nausea 
: feeling of discomfort in the epigastrium with a conscious desire to vomit. 
Vomiting 
: forceful ejection of partially digested food and secretions (emesis) from the 
upper GI tract. 
regurgitation 
: process in which partially digested food is slowly brought up from the stomach. 
Retching or vomiting seldom precedes it. 
projectile vomiting 
: very forceful expulsion of stomach contents without nausea and is a 
characteristic of CNS tumours or increased ICP.
